What you need to know about The Terminal Kampala Festival to happen in Uganda for three days (30 & 31st December, 1st jan 2023)

Kampala: Terminal Music Records has announced a three- days music and experiential festival dubbed The Terminal Kampala. The Terminal Kampala will happen in Uganda starting on December 30th up to January 1st 2023 and it is the biggest party experience this festive season.

After happening in countries like Kuwait, Oman, The UK and Kenya, the first ever Ugandan edition will happen this year. The announcement was made at Skyz Hotel Naguru by Mr Daniel Ebo and Chris Bitti, the organisers of the three days event.The festival will feature 25 artists of which 10 international artists across Africa and Europe performing alongside Ugandan acts.
The artists confirmed for the Terminal Kampala include Camidoh from Ghana, Dope Nation from Ghana , Ya Levis from France, Marioo from Tanzania, Shasha from Zimbabwe, Black Motion from South Africa, DJ Edu from London and DJ Lochive from South Africa among others.
Ugandan performers include Sheebah Karungi, Kataleya and Kandle, Ykee Benda, Fik Fumaica, DJ Shiru, DJ Bankrobber, DJ Lito, DJ Naselow, DJ Zato, DJ Nimrod, just to name a few.
According to Mr Daniel Ebo, the festival will bring you the artists you know and love and also introduce new artists and music that you may not be familiar with, but would enjoy. We are also here to support the Ugandan entertainment industry and aim to contribute through creating employment, working with young entrepreneurs, SME’s and sharing the knowledge and experience we have gained from our previous events and bringing something special that focuses on a heightened consumer experience.
The event is categorised in three different themes and different artists will perform on different days. The first day, December 30th is dubbed “Young and Sexy” at Cricket Oval featuring Marioo, DopeNation, Kataleya and Kandle and DJs Maker Breaker, Shiru and Lito entertain revellers.
The second day (31st December) dubbed is “Into ‘23” as it will usher Ugandans into 2023. Also Happening at Cricket Oval, featured music acts are Camidoh, Ya Elvis, Shasha, DJs Edu,  DJ Zato, DJ Naselow Dan Don and DJ Nimrod. This day will also see a display of fireworks at midnight to welcome a new year.
This event is a highly experiential one starting at 5pm to allow our attendees to dive into thrilling adventures at the experiential area and witness a spectacular transition into 2023.The last day of the event called “the Big Chill” will take place at Skyz Hotel Naguru featuring Black Motion, DJs Bankrobber and Kash Pro. More of a chilled, sophisticated event, The Big Chill is the perfect place to celebrate the New year in style.
The Terminal Kampala has promised a world class event production and according to Chris Bitti, besides the music, the event experience is what sets the Terminal Kampala apart from other events.
